I was travelling with a friend, and left it up to him to book the hotel, so I didn't really know what to expect, but this hotel is really like nothing you can expect anyway.
The hotel is decorated by an award-winning designer, and done entirely in black, red and gold. This could result either in the place looking like a whore house, or extremely dramatic and spectacular, and luckily, The Toren landed on the last result.
The hotel is relatively small, situated in a quiet area not far from Anne Franks House and The Nine Streets, so a LOT of interesting shops nearby.
The hallways in the hotel are dark, and decorated lavishly to the point of almost ridiculous, EVERYTHING is glossy finishes, velvet, cut-glass, chandeliers and huge fake flower arrangements.
The rom wasn't VERY big, but very well-equipped, with flatscreen tv with cable (and several english language stations), an ipod docking station, a complimentary nespresso machine, and a huge bathroom, actually almost the same size as the rest of the room. The bathroom was just closed off from the rest of the room by a curtain, but had a large shower with a rainfall showerhead, and the biggest jacuzzi i have ever seen in a bathroom. The jacuzzi had several programs,and built-in colored lights. Oh yes.
We were happy to find that despite the whole curtain-scenario, the toilet was shielded by a door.
The room was like the rest of the hotel done in a black, red and gold color scheme, and the bathroom was largely in black marble. The bed was extremely comfortable, VERY big and had lots of pillows and cushions.
If you go for the look that this hotel has chosen, wear and tear IS going to show, but why mope about the fact that there are some scratches in the wallpaper, if you look closely? I prefer to focus on the point of thoughtful and luxurious complementaries, such as the Nespresso machine, and some extremely nice toiletries, by Rituals.
Breakfast is served in a room that doubles as bar for the rest of the day/night, and the room itself is quite something. Breakfast was not included in our rate, bur had a great selection, and the food was delicious, well worth it.
Service at the hotel is efficient and friendly, but professional. My friend had problems with his credit card when we were checking out, and they couldn't have been more helpful in a stressful situation like that. We were very happy with our stay.
